The successful candidate will be registered as a Health Care Aide in BC (BCCACHWR), with a passion for providing high quality care and support for seniors. 

We are looking for someone who:
  • Responds to scheduled and unscheduled requests from tenants for assistance with bathing, dressing, grooming, toileting, mobility, medication management, housekeeping and meal management at times of the tenant’s choosing.
  • Follows the tenant Service Plan and Managed Risk Agreement when delivering personal care and hospitality services.
  • Participates in the delivery of social and recreational programs including group activities, outings, special events, communal impromptu gatherings and opportunities for socialization. Takes initiative in organizing unscheduled social and recreational opportunities wherever possible (i.e. card games, movies, gardening, etc.).
  • Assists with dining room meal preparation and services as directed.
  • Attends to requests for tenant companionship to reduce or prevent social isolation or to respond to changes in tenant health and functional status.
  • Reports changes in functional capacity, mood or health status to the Community Manager or designate.
  • Participates in tenant review meetings at the call of the Community Manager/delegate.
  • Performs delegated tasks in support of tenant personal care after completion of tenant specific training.
  • Performs administrative tasks as required.
  • Participates in program planning and evaluation and in Quality Improvement activities.

The successful candidate will meet the below qualifications:
  • Successful completion of Grade 12.
  • Successful completion of a recognized Assisted Living Worker program or equivalent and current BC Care Aide and Community Health Worker Registry.
  • Able to provide a  negative TB Screening test and full proof of Immunization Record.
  • Possesses a Clear Vulnerable Sector and Criminal Record check
